THE UST Lady Tennisters trampled the Ateneo de Manila University to advance to the finals while their male counterparts are a win away from playing for the title in the UAAP lawn tennis tournament at the Rizal Memorial Stadium Saturday.

The Lady Tennisters made quick work of the Lady Eagles, 4-1, to book their third straight finals appearance while the Male Tennisters have to win one of their remaining two assignments to advance in the finals despite edging the Blue Eagles, 3-2.

Precian Rivera survived a hard-fought battle against Ateneo’s Khrizelle Sampaton, 6-4, 4-6, 6-4, as teammate Erika Manduriao followed suit with a 6-1, 6-0 rout of Rocio Clement.

UST’s duo of Lennelyn Milo-Marie Ann San Jose and Shymae Gitalan-Ingrid Gonzales punctuated the day with back-to-back wins in the doubles category.

Only Immaville Gervacio dropped a match for the Lady Tennisters as she faltered against Lady Eagle Jana Pages, 3-6, 2-6.

“I’m happy with how the girls played today. Coming from a loss, they were eager to win again,” Lady Tennisters head coach Dennis Sta. Cruz told the Varsitarian. “It’s a good finish sa second round to keep the morale high going into the finals.”

In men’s play, Male Tennister Nico Lanzado secured the win for UST as Ateneo’s Luke Flores was forced to retire after succumbing to fatigue and cramps, 6-3, 3-6, 1-4.

UST’s En-En Lopez and Dave Mosqueda both dropped their singles matches but its two doubles teams racked up back-to-back sweeps.

Joel Cabusas and Bernlou Bering crushed Ateneo pair Erj Gatdula and AJ Rivero, 6-1, 6-4, while the Male Tennister duo of Clarence Cabahug and Warren Lagahit pulled off a 6-3, 6-4 manhandling of Anton Punzalan and Julian Dayrit.

Should the Male Tennisters defeat either the University of the East or the National University, they will secure a spot in the finals. If NU loses to Ateneo tomorrow, the Male Tennisters are assured of a finals appearance even if they do not win either of their remaining two games.

The Male Tennisters will face the undefeated UE squad tomorrow, 8 a.m., at the same venue.
